About The Company
Based in Portland, Oregon, Columbia Sportswear Company (NASDAQ: COLM) is a global outdoor brand that crafts active lifestyle gear fortified with industry-leading technologies and tested in our backyard. Our apparel, footwear, and accessories reflect our Pacific Northwest heritage and indomitable spirit. Over the last 80 years, Columbia and our family of brands, Sorel, prAna, and Mountain Hardwear, have grown to over 10,000 employees and proudly sell products in over 100 countries. About the Role

ABOUT THE POSITION

Columbia Sportswear Compnay's Human Resources organization aims to advance company strategy and connect talented people with their passions through work and a life outside. We need passionate people to create exceptional products, and differentiated consumer experiences, and to grow the business. Our teams ensure the company's success by focusing on attracting and retaining diverse talent, building organizational effectiveness, and supporting the mental, physical, social and financial well-being of all employees. Can you help us drive the changes that will positively affect Columbia Sportswear Company, its employees, its customers, and its consumers?

As a HR Generalist, you will play a key role in supporting our organization by providing comprehensive human resources expertise. You will work closely with HR manager, department managers, and employees at all levels to deliver guidance on HR policies and practices, ensuring compliance and fostering a positive work environment. You will partner with leadership on staffing, compensation, benefits, and employee relations. You will also drive process improvements, support business-unit initiatives, and contribute to internal HR programs through data analysis, manager coaching, and employee engagement activities. Additionally, you will oversee onboarding programs, respond to policy inquiries, and train managers on HR procedures.

This role requires strong interpersonal skills, a proactive approach, and the ability to balance day-to-day HR operations with strategic projects that enhance organizational effectiveness.

HOW YOU'LL MAKE A DIFFERENCE

  • Executes on employee issues. Provides guidance. Explains and interprets policies and practices.
  • Assists middle managers and employees with development coaching based on current programs in the portfolio. 
  • Provides hands-on support to employees and managers and identifies trends for improvement and training.
  • Aids Centers of Excellence (COE) with HR compliance through reviews of policies and legislation. 
  • Manages investigations (Tier 1 and Tier II). Performs initial intake and consults with Sr HR Generalist where escalation and recommendations lead to a performance action.  
  • Provides management training on HR policies and procedures in a group or individual setting.
  • Continually enhances knowledge of state and federal regulations and current trends/practices pertaining to HR. Attends training and educational courses to enhance knowledge of all HR areas. 
  • Understands the need for appropriate data privacy protections when working with employee data. 

YOU ARE

  • Solve a variety of problems that may be somewhat difficult and varied in nature. Consult with staff members on more complex issues.
  • Exercise judgment within defined parameters to make decisions on tasks with limited scope or complexity. Receive moderate level of guidance and direction on complex tasks.
  • Working knowledge of the principles, practices and concepts within own job discipline; have broadened capability through practical experience in applying theories.
  • Understand key business drivers; demonstrates knowledge of the organization and processes; use this understanding to accomplish their own work.
  • Explain and simplify complex information to others; lead the coordination of information to ensure ongoing process or program execution.
  • No supervisory responsibilities.

YOU HAVE

  • Bachelor’s degree, applicable certification or equivalent experience.
  • Typically requires 3-5 years of professional experience, and general proficiency with tools, systems, and procedures required to accomplish the job.
  • Ability to apply privacy concepts rooted in core privacy principles, like Data Minimization, when collecting, using, or sharing personal information of our job candidates and employee
